You will be part of a small team responsible for carrying out general maintenance of parks, playing fields and other open spaces within the Ribble Valley to maintain high quality facilities and a pleasant environment.
You will be involved in grass cutting, hedge trimming, clearing leaves and litter, setting up sports equipment, planting, pruning and seeding as well as helping with the upkeep of artificial synthetic sports pitches.
You will work towards a Level 2 Horticulture Operative Standard qualification through Myerscough College. This qualification is work based but will require occasional attendance at Myerscough College for assessments.
